黑马程序员技术交流社区

标题: java基础-关于 JVM 、JDK、JRE, JavaSE、JavaEE, JavaME, GC [打印本页]

作者: tuan2016    时间: 2016-5-17 11:47
标题: java基础-关于 JVM 、JDK、JRE, JavaSE、JavaEE, JavaME, GC
本帖最后由 tuan2016 于 2016-5-17 13:24 编辑
JVM 、JDK、JRE, JavaSE、JavaEE, JavaME, GC的意思


JVM: Java 虚拟机, Java Virtual Machine 的缩写。是一个虚掏出来的计算机, 通过在实际的计算机上仿真模拟各种计算机功能来实现的。Java 虚拟机有自己完善的硬体架构,如处理器、堆栈、寄存器等,还具有相应的指令系统。JVM 屏蔽了与具体操作系统平台相关的信息,使得Java 程序只需生成在Java 虚拟机上运行的目标代码(字节码 ) , 就可以在多种平台上末加修改地运行。


JDK: Java 开发土具包, Java Development Kit 的缩写。JDK 是整个Java 的核心包括了Java 运行环境、Java 开发工具和Java 基础类库。


JRE : Java 运行环境, Java Runtime Environment 的缩写。运行JAVA 程序所必须的环境的集合,包含JVM 标准实现及Java 核心类库。


Java SE : Java Standard Edition ,标准版,是我们常用的一个版本,从JDK5.O 开始,改名为Java SE ,主要用于桌面应用软件的编程。


JavaEE : Java Enterprise Edition ,企业版。Java EE 是J2EE 的一个新的名称,主要用于分布式的网络丰富予的开发。


Java ME : Java Micro Edition是为机顶盒、移动电话和PDA 之类嵌入式油费电子设备提供Java 语言平台,包括虚拟机和一系列标准化的Java API。


GC :垃圾回收, Garbage Collection 的缩写。当Java 虚拟机发觉内存资源紧张时,则会自动地去清理无用对象(没有被引用到的对象)所占用的内存空间。


作者: deqiqi939788736    时间: 2016-5-17 13:08
赞一个,就是喜欢好东西要分享




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2